Our client is a leading competitor in the Fire and Security industry, and they are growing rapidly! With a track record of providing fantastic career opportunities, they are seeking a Fire and Security Engineer to cover Glasgow and the surrounding area.
Responsibilities:
- Manage your own workload.
- Fault diagnosis, repairs, servicing, maintenance, small works of fire alarm systems, security systems (CCTV, intruder alarms, access control), and related equipment for both commercial and residential clients.
Requirements:
- Proven experience as a Fire and Security Engineer.
- Ability to troubleshoot and diagnose faults in electrical systems and fire/security equipment.
- Excellent communication and customer service skills.
- Full UK driving license.
- Flexible and willing to travel across Glasgow and the surrounding area.
